Mesothelioma
Mesothelioma is a rare and fatal form of cancer that affects the lining of the lung or abdomen. It has been linked to asbestos exposure. The cause of this disease is inhaling and swallowing fibers of asbestos that float in the air. These particles can end up in the lungs and cause inflammation or tumors. The symptoms of mesothelioma could take years to show up and can be severe. People who have been diagnosed with mesothelioma must seek medical attention as soon as possible. They should also speak with a mesothelioma attorney to determine if they have legal options.
Asbestos was widely employed in industrial and construction products. It is a naturally occurring fiber that is renowned for its heat resistance and malleable strength. It was utilized in construction, ships, power plants and other places before it was banned. Asbestos was a danger to workers in these industries as they handled the products or transported them to other locations.

Social Security Disability
A Baltimore asbestos lawyer can assist you in applying for disability benefits if exposure to asbestos has left you too sick to work. This is a separate program from workers' compensation. Both require proof of exposure to asbestos as well as the medical diagnosis of mesothelioma, or any other asbestos-related illness. You should also provide detailed information about your symptoms and any treatment you have received. Your lawyer can assist you to understand the specific requirements for each.
To be eligible for SSDI you must show that your condition will or has been present for at minimum one year and could cause death. In most cases, your mesothelioma will be able to meet this requirement. You must also show that your condition is severe and limiting that you are unable to do any kind of work. If you are able to perform other tasks, the SSA will determine if it is SGA (substantially gainful activity).
The SSA has released an extensive list in a publication entitled "The Blue Book" of conditions that automatically qualify for benefits. The SSA will review the condition you're suffering from to determine if it is compatible or is medically equivalent to a list. If not however, the SSA will make a decision that you are disabled.

Trust Funds
Asbestos may cause mesothelioma, which is a lethal form of cancer. The disease might not be apparent until decades after the initial exposure. It's important to seek legal advice from mesothelioma attorneys as soon as you can. A mesothelioma lawyer can assist you get the financial compensation you're entitled to.
Asbestos trust funds are created to pay compensation to those who have suffered from asbestos-related injuries. They are usually created to settle claims against manufacturers who have gone bankrupt because of asbestos lawsuits. A mesothelioma attorney can help you determine if you are eligible to claim a trust fund.
